Ironworker Salary in Leavenworth, KS —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a ironworker in Leavenworth, KS is $39,617 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 85.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ering Leavenworth's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level ironworker professionals in Leavenworth can expect to earn around $20,752 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level ironworkers earning approximately $55,339 per year. This represents a 167% increase from entry to senior level.

Cost of Living Adjustment

Leavenworth's cost of living index of 85 significantly impacts salary comparisons. As a lower cost-of-living city, salaries in Leavenworth are adjusted accordingly. This means that while the nominal salary may appear higher or lower than the national average of $56,840, the actual purchasing power must be considered in context.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a ironworker's salary in Leavenworth typ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$750 per month, housing represents about 22.7%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.

Career Growth and Opportunities

Ironworkers are in growing demand across the United States, with an expected job growth of 12% over the next decade. In Leavenworth, this translates to increasing opportunities and potential for salary growth as demand for experienced professionals continues to rise.
